      In August, my client's site (I work at a marketing agency) had about 15,000 backlinks. Now they suddenly have about 10,000 backlinks. And their Domain Authority has dropped from 48 to 40!

      Can someone please help me understand what could've happened?

      At first I assumed this had something to do with the latest Penguin update, since I knew my client's site had some extremely spammy backlinks they hadn't cleaned up yet. (The site was hacked at some point and hidden pages were created as part of some kind of link-building scheme, and there were lots of links from sketchy sites to those pages. The hidden pages have been taken down and the URLs now redirect to my client's home page.) But that would only explain a sudden drop in Domain Authority, right? How could Penguin suddenly cause my client to lose 5,000 backlinks? And if it's not Penguin, what could it be?

        Firstly, sounds like you do have a penalty of some sort.

        Secondly, I would not have redirected the hacked pages back to the site anywhere, you could give yourself a penalty that way. You could be passing bad authority or worse from anywhere else on the web, completely out of your control.

        Thirdly, don't discount the potential of a website problem. Broken script, user damage, another hack etc

        1. Do a thorough link cleanup.

        2. Consider taking down any pages that are not relevant or earning any value.

        3. Check search console for any notifications or manual penalties.

        4. Check the website for performance and functionality.

          Sorry just a question, where are you getting your back links list from? It's not unknown for tools to be inaccurate.

          Another point I forgot to mention, Moz did update their index in the past few days, lots of people have seen a DA drop.

                If it was my site I would seriously consider getting rid of any redirects from old dodgy pages, you could force Google to consider for the content still exists.  If it goes to a 404 Google can then see clearly it no longer exists.
                But would be interesting on what others have to say on that.

                I would source my back links mainly from Google search console.
